What Is The Average Salary After MS In Entrepreneurship In USA?

While salaries can vary widely in the entrepreneurial world, graduates from top US universities often see impressive returns on their investments. On average, alumni with a master’s in entrepreneurship can expect to start around $70,000 to $120,000 annually, depending on factors like location, industry, and individual performance. But remember, the sky’s the limit when you’re equipped with the right business skills and a global entrepreneurial mindset!

Now, let’s talk about how to bump up that salary with your shiny new MS degree:

Network like your career depends on it (because it does!)

In the cutthroat world of business, your network can be your secret weapon to rise above the competition. Don’t just collect business cards at events – build real relationships. Reach out to alumni from your program, especially those who’ve successfully launched a new venture. Set up coffee chats, attend industry meetups, and join professional groups on LinkedIn. These connections can help students like you land high-paying roles or find investors for your own startup ideas. Remember, in the entrepreneurial world, who you know can be just as important as what you know.

Get your hands dirty with real-world projects

Theory is great, but to truly stand out in the competitive job market, you need practical experience. Look for programs that help students gain hands-on experience through consulting projects for real startups or internships with established companies. These experiences not only beef up your resume but also give you stories to tell during interviews. Plus, they might even spark ideas for your own new venture. Being able to say, “I helped a local startup increase their revenue by 30% using strategies I learned in my global entrepreneurial finance class” is way more impressive than just listing courses you’ve taken.

Specialize in a high-demand niche

The business world is vast and competition is fierce, so find your sweet spot to stand out. Maybe you’re passionate about sustainable energy, or you’ve got a knack for fintech. Whatever it is, use your time during the MS program to become an expert in that area. Take relevant electives, do research projects, and maybe even write your thesis on it. This specialization can help students position themselves as experts rather than generalists, potentially commanding a higher salary. Plus, your niche knowledge might be just what you need to spot a gap in the market for your new venture.

FAQs

Why choose the USA for an MS in Entrepreneurship?

The USA offers a dynamic environment with top universities, a diverse culture, and strong industry connections, fostering innovation and entrepreneurial success.

Are there scholarships for international students?

Yes, international students can access various scholarships, including merit-based and need-based options, making education more affordable.

What career opportunities await MS in Entrepreneurship graduates?

Graduates can embark on roles like Business Development Managers, Startup Consultants, or Entrepreneurs. Salaries vary but generally range between $60,000 to $100,000+.

How can international students navigate the US visa process?

Navigating the visa process involves securing admission, demonstrating financial stability, and attending an embassy interview. Post-study work visas like the H-1B are available.

What’s the future of entrepreneurship education in the USA?

The future entails sustainable practices and AI integration. US universities continuously update curricula to prepare graduates for emerging trends.
